I spent quite a lot of time trying to figure out why the same piece of function runs in MATLAB but not in a MATLAB function block called by Simulink. Then, I saw this post made two years ago about how implicit scalar expansion doesn't work for MATLAB function blocks for some reason and using bsxfun is one way to get around that. I just wanted to check if there's any update on this issue.. I'd rather not write two separate versions of the same thing if I can avoid it.
function ans = fcn()
ans = ones(4,3) .^ ones(4,1);
